Biography
Rafael Sá Carneiro (born 14 September 2002, Lisbon, Portugal) is a filmmaker, screenwriter and performer whose work lives at the intersection of cinema, drawing, music and performance. A recent graduate in Film & Media Arts from the Universidade Lusófona de Lisboa, he charts human stories with emotional clarity and a collaborative spirit. In 2023 he made the short film Évora, a contemplative portrait of place and memory. He co-wrote and directed the series Pena Negra (with João Severo), and in 2025 released the film A Hora do Chico! , alongside the documentary short The Doors of Perception.
